ACP Accreditation Officer

NHS AfC: Band 5

Trosolwg o'r swydd

We are looking for an looking for an enthusiastic and motivated ACP Accreditation Officer to support the team responsible for delivering the National Advancing Practice programme in NHS England.

The post holder will work with other members in the team and wider directorate to ensure their workstreams and programmes are planned and managed effectively. The role will be key in assisting delivery of the programme’s objectives and mandate obligations.

Prif ddyletswyddau'r swydd

Duties will include:

  • Arranging meetings for the Programme Team and support the planning of conferences, meetings, independent panels and events.
  • Supporting the process of reviewing Advanced Practice Programmes
  • Being a point of contact and advice for a range of external stakeholders, internal colleagues, and senior managers
    Providing admin support to the programme.
  • Regularly liaising with and negotiating with senior stakeholders and their offices on difficult and controversial issues.
  • Tracking all project plans and actions across the team, highlighting potential risks and delays in delivery.
  • Providing and receiving complex, sensitive and often contentious information.
